I was back home around noon and I was starving. I knew I wanted an Asian stir fry with some veggies I bought at the Asian grocery store last week so I searched the Internet but couldn't find anything that sounded good so I attempted my own thing:

1 package tofu
bunch of kale
Napa cabbage
shredded carrots
bean sprouts
soy sauce
1 tablespoon canola oil
1/2 tablespoon sesame oil

I roasted the tofu in the while I stir fried the veggies in a pan. Mixed it all together and it was done. This will be my lunch for the week.
